default root password needed

walter baziuk
Level 5
Level 5

i am on the sourfire/firepower  system console

i need to run SUDo or Su root

both prompt for a password.

its none of the ones i have set.i donr recall ever setting one

when i go to the gui, it wont let me create a reserved account ie root

i need this password  to run  commands to migrate away from V6.0.0.1-26 to v 6.1.0

i have an open Sev 3 TAC ticket

so far TAC has not been helpful on the upgrade issue or password

anyone else know what the issue is

Hello Walter,

If you havent set any specific password, then it would be the default password same as admin user. Starting from 6.0 the default credentials are different from previous 5.4 versions.

Login to the firepower CLI and once you login as admin user , use the following commands to put the default root password.

admin@123$ sudo su  -

Put the default password and it will help you in switching to the root account.
